$(this).closest('li').addClass('crt')
})
点击后添加class的同时, 相邻的li移除class:
$('.us-con-lf>ul').on('click','li>a',function(){$(this).closest('li').addClass('crt').siblings().removeClass('crt')
})
刚刚试了一下你的代码,结果是不是和上面图片上这个一样的。首先代码不建议这样写,代码不规范后面很容易报错的,你的ul标签没有结尾。因为整个LI都是超链接,那里面的内容就不可能会被点击到,所以只能做JS跳转。具体代码可以上网查询。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)